Transaction ef838c2fa7f6ce8b45632ae7639ef386493468b6e0195c5464310a75d9631492
1 Input
1 Output
-
ef838c2fa7f6ce8b45632ae7639ef386493468b6e0195c5464310a75d9631492:0
- value
- 179062
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 36cb333d4c78ed3fe5f594f83c27ced9ad245c2e7389ac2942fa8de90c3d1b21
- address
- bc1pxm9nx02v0rknle04jnurcf7wmxkjghpwwwy6c22zl2x7jrparvssptcve6